Shopkeeper Threatens Town With Porno Abbondanza
KIRO-TV 7 Seattle | Submitted by: gargoyle1
"Levi Bussanich wants the city to change wetland buffers so he can build a grocery store. If he doesn't get his way he said he's going to expand his adult video store into a sex emporium... The sex emporium would include both female and male strippers along with live sex shows. It would also include a complete bondage and fetish area, an adult motel and a drive-through window for then what the owner calls "great customer access."

I'm assuming he's building the grocery store on a different property. Around here, they name a property a protected wetland, to fuck land owners over. The Detroit area was built on marshland. We've been draining it for over a century. This particular city was woods, farms, and swampy in the low spots.

A friend of mine bought an old house on the main road. The city hates most of these old, former farm houses. They'd rather have strip malls, and other businesses. His property was never wet, but there was "protected" marsh behind it. A developer built a subdivision on that land, raising it, and forcing the water into the back of his backyard, and most of it to the nursery, next door.

He tried to fill it in, but was fined and threatened with more fines that would compete with the worth of his house. After a couple years, the nursery was allowed to raise their property, forcing the water into his entire backyard. Still, he wasn't allowed to fix it.

After spending too much, in vain, on lawyers, he ended up taking a huge loss on the property, which is now a nice dry strip mall.

This is not an isolated incident. Right now we have a church who just filled in several acres of marsh, on land the homeowners lost because they weren't allowed to get rid of the water forced into their yards by subdivisions, and they just bought several similar lots, directly across the street.
